Day 1: Ha Giang to Yen Minh

Easy Rider 4 Days High Quality Small Group + Private Room - Day 1: Ha Giang to Yen Minh

The tour kicks off with a scenic journey from Ha Giang to Yen Minh, traversing the breathtaking Pac Sum Pass and visiting the alluring Heaven Gate along the way.

Next, the group explores the charming Nam Dam Village, gaining insight into the local hill-tribe culture. Here, they’ll witness traditional weaving demonstrations and have the opportunity to interact with the friendly residents.

After lunch, the tour continues to Yen Minh, a picturesque town nestled amidst the rolling hills and valleys. Travelers will have time to wander the lively markets, sample local cuisine, and soak in the serene atmosphere before retiring for the evening.

Day 2: Yen Minh to Meo Vac

After exploring the charming town of Yen Minh, the group heads out to the Tham Ma Road, a scenic route renowned for its winding turns and stunning vistas.

Along the way, they’ll visit the Hmong King Palace, an impressive historical site that offers a glimpse into the region’s rich cultural heritage.

Next, they’ll trek to the Lung Cu Flag Pole, the northernmost point of Vietnam, where they can capture breathtaking panoramic views.

Finally, they’ll arrive in the picturesque town of Meo Vac, nestled amidst the dramatic mountain landscapes.

With each new destination, the group gains a deeper appreciation for the unique blend of natural beauty and cultural traditions that define this mesmerizing region.

Day 3: Meo Vac to Du Gia

Easy Rider 4 Days High Quality Small Group + Private Room - Day 3: Meo Vac to Du Gia

Departing Meo Vac, the group traverses the awe-inspiring Ma Pi Leng Pass, a high-altitude mountain route renowned for its dramatic limestone peaks and sweeping vistas.

Descending into the Mau Due Valley, they’re greeted by the vibrant hues of terraced rice paddies.

The tour then continues to the remote Du Gia Village, where they’ll have the opportunity to enjoy the unique culture and traditions of the local hill tribe people.

Along the way, the guide shares insights into the region’s history and way of life, enriching the overall experience.

With each stop, the group gains a deeper appreciation for the raw beauty and engrossing diversity of Northern Vietnam’s landscapes and communities.

Day 4: Du Gia to Hanoi

Easy Rider 4 Days High Quality Small Group + Private Room - Day 4: Du Gia to Hanoi

On the final day of the tour, the group departs Du Gia Village and heads towards the Duong Thuong Valley, where they marvel at the terraced rice paddies cascading down the hillsides.

Continuing their journey, they make a stop at the picturesque Bac Me town before reaching Ha Giang, the final destination of the motorbike adventure.

From there, the group is transported back to Hanoi, concluding this immersive exploration of Northern Vietnam’s enchanting landscapes and vibrant local cultures.

Along the way, they soak in the scenic vistas and reflect on the cultural insights gained throughout the journey. As the tour comes to an end, the travelers feel a newfound appreciation for the beauty and richness of this remarkable region.
